About Us

We are a concerned group of people from the Philadelphia area who share an interest in the people and countries of the New World - the Americas. We are from all walks of life, and from all of the countries of the Western Hemisphere. We are educators, political scientists, diplomats, business and community leaders, students, and just plain concerned citizens. 

Regardless of our heritage or experience, we all share a common goal – to pursue “Panamericanismo” – that special relationship that exists among the people and countries of the Western Hemisphere.

As members of the Pan American Association, we wish to deepen our knowledge of the countries of the Western Hemisphere, broaden our friendships, and enjoy the infinite variety of the social and cultural experience of our family of nations.

During the year we carry out a calendar of varied events that are open to members and their guests, and which highlight many aspects of the Western Hemisphere's political, social and cultural environment.

Principal Activities Include:

  • Scholarships and Awards - Annual scholarships, prizes and awards issued on a competitive basis to students who excel in Latin American studies at area colleges and universities.
  • Contemporary Lectures - Guest speakers who are subject-matter experts in Western Hemisphere matters affecting the political, social, and cultural relationships among the peoples of the Americas.
  • Social Events - seasonal parties and cultural get-togethers are held periodically, to build comraderie among members, recruit new members, and to support the Association's fundraising for scholarships and educational programs. 
  • Joint Ventures - the Association cooperates with a wide variety of organizations involved in educational, social, and cultural activities related to the Western Hemisphere, as well as many Philadelphia-based community organizations.
